The distribution of fiber optic sensors in oil & gas import shipments in France saw a shift towards greater diversification in 2024, with top exporting countries including the USA, Japan, India, Germany, and the Netherlands. This diversification contributed to a decrease in market concentration levels from moderate to low, indicating a more competitive landscape. The compound annual growth rate (CAGR) from 2020 to 2024 experienced a decline of -10.18%, with a notable decrease in growth rate from 2023 to 2024 at -18.26%.
